Fry Top: 15mm thick cooking plate, fully independent from the surface. It features a wide, drainable channel around the entire perimeter of the plate to collect cooking residues, sloped towards the front for liquid drainage into a large grease collection drawer. The plate is not welded, allowing for quicker maintenance and potential replacements on-site. It ensures thermal uniformity, with a thermal cut that benefits both the user and adjacent machinery, reducing energy consumption by 15% compared to traditional models.
